WebPeanut plants, Arachis hypogaea, grow best during a long, hot growing season. Plant Peanuts in early to mid April when the soil has warmed sufficiently. Remove the seeds from the shells and the skin from the seeds, then plant them about 1 to 1 1/2 inches deep and three inches apart. The rows should be 30-36 inches apart. WebMay 10, 2013 · This flowering and pegging goes on for more than a month, and meanwhile the plants grow into sprawling bushes. When the plants finally begin dying back, or before the first frost, the plants are pulled up, roots and all, during a period of dry weather.
